This page is dedicated
in loving memory of my father, who was not only a great father, but a great
husband to my mother and a great person to for the town. He was devoted
to making sure all of the kids in this town had something constructive
to do. That, in part was why the Booster Club of Walton was started. It
is a non-profit organization started to give the children of Walton a chance
at being recognized for something, and to keep them off the streets. This
program was about more than playing football, baseball, cheerleading or
any other sport that is run by the Booster Club. It was about people learning
that "Winning isn't everything," and "to be a true winner, you have to
start somewhere." My father showed me what it is like to give, and I will
always treasure that. He was a great example of a man, and he always took
people's feelings into consideration. It is in part, why I am what I am
today. Afterall, if he didn't take me to give out present to families that
didn't have anything on Christmas Eve, I would have lost out on the great
feeling of seeing the look on those people's faces. Dad, if you can read
this..THANKS!
Unfortunately,
my father passed away in January, 1992 at the young age of 46. He had been
strucken with Lung Cancer, which he faught desperately for two years. He
never once gave up, and it was because of his family that he faught so
hard. There were some great things in my life that my father didn't get
to see, because when he died, I was only 16. I didn't get to see him smiling
proudly at me as I strolled through the crowd, as I made my way to the
center of the floor when I made Prom Court. I didn't get to see him grinning
at me when I was handed my graduation dimploma from high school or college.
I didn't get the thumbs-up when I brought my first girlfriend home, and
I didn't get to hear him tell me it would be ok when I lost my first true
love. These are all things that most people take for granted. Please, never
assume someone will be there in the future. Make the best of what you have
now.
My father touched
many lives in the short time he was here on this planet. He was a mentor
to kids, and he was an idol to a lot of people. He is the kind of person
the world could use more of. I can remember that most of the students in
the school here came to show their respect to my father, and that is not
something that happens in today's world. He is missed, by all who knew
him.
